Below we've compiled a list of the most critical support representative skills. We ranked the top skills for support representatives based on the percentage of resumes they appeared on. For example, 10.3% of support representative resumes contained patients as a skill. Continue reading to find out what skills a support representative needs to be successful in the workplace.

2. Customer Service

Customer service is the process of offering assistance to all the current and potential customers -- answering questions, fixing problems, and providing excellent service. The main goal of customer service is to build a strong relationship with the customers so that they keep coming back for more business.

Here's how support representatives use customer service:
  • Participated in the retention and attainment of servicing account volume through the consistent delivery of excellent internal and external customer service.
  • Navigate multiple systems and apply customer service and direct sales expertise in order to provide accurate and timely delivery of Thirty-One products

3. Troubleshoot

Troubleshooting is the process of analyzing and fixing any kind of problem in a system or a machine. Troubleshooting is the detailed yet quick search in the system for the main source of an issue and solving it.

Here's how support representatives use troubleshoot:
  • Maintained an effective working knowledge of network infrastructure and utilized that knowledge to effectively troubleshoot components to resolve customer related issues.
  • Acted as liaison between nursing/clinical areas with Information Technology Department and Patient Billing to troubleshoot hospital revenue issues.

5. Technical Support

Technical support or tech support are the services provided by any hardware or software company to users. They help in solving the technical difficulties the customers face with their products or services. Moreover, the tech support employees maintain, manage, and repair the IT faults. They are also responsible for resolving the network problems, installing and configuring hardware and software.

Here's how support representatives use technical support:
  • Provide technical support to ensure Drive Wise device and mobile application is communicating properly and data is being disseminated for analyzing.
  • Provide post-integration technical support for business partners by investigating the interaction of their software systems with the HomeAway integration platforms.
